in our party we will have 2 adult females and girlies 11 and 13. I have seen some things related to the spa for teens but the listed age is 13 and up. My then 11 yr old would want to do things worth her sister. Would this be allowed? If so do you have details about what is offered and cost?
 
Not sure if they will let 11 year old in teen spa. I don't know how to post link (new laptop) but at top of these boards there is a Hawaii link that has a link to teen spa. Looks like they can have facials, mani, pedi, make lotions etc.

However if they will get any massage an adult has to be present. I'm talking sitting in the room literally. So a couple massage is only way it seems to make sense. They had a Minnie Mouse menu for 12 and under. Mani pedi, hair etc.

My daughter had just turned 14 last year when we went and I had scheduled a massage for she and I both. When we arrived they told me she couldn't go back. It took a long chat with the manager to get that squared away. The spa is a very quiet area, so I get they don't want kids back there for that reason. We stayed there for about 5 hours and I never saw anyone who wasn't an adult back in the gardens or in the relaxation room. You might want to give them a call and square it away so you don't have to deal with it when you get there.
 

We have not yet been, but are going in June. I called to book massages for my DDs ages 15 & 13. They said I had 2 options.. if they got full massage, adult had to be present. She suggested me getting one at the same time but that is not a relaxing option lol. Option 2 was a 25 minute massage in the teen spa. Since they fall within the ages, no adult present, they can wear swimwear or loose fitting clothes, its already hooked up to charge to the room and add gratuity so they can truly go on their own. We went with option 2. Haven't been yet, so hopefully it will work out well. I booked them a 25 min massage and a facial in the Teen Spa.
 
We are going in March and I booked the side by side massage with my 15 year old, I choose this over the teen massage because they said they aren't allowed in the hydrotherapy gardens if they only get the teen services.
